FROG: Nervus System***************************************************************** Study and Remval f the Frg's Brain Starting at the mst anterir part f the head, the lfactry nerves cnnect t the nstrils and then t the lfactry lbes (A) where drs are prcessed. Just psterir t the lfactry lbes are tw elngate bdies with runded bases, this is the cerebrum (B), and it is the frg's thinking center. The cerebrum is the part f the brain that helps the frg respnd t its envirnment. Psterir t the cerebrum are the ptic lbes (C), which functin in visin. The ridge just behind the ptic lbes is the cerebellum (D), it is used t crdinate the frg's muscles and maintain balance. Psterir t the cerebellum is the medulla blngata (E) which cntrls respiratin, circulatin, and ther bdily functins; it als cnnects the brain t the spinal crd (F). Cmplete the chart.
